JavaScript Scope & Closure — Concepts You MUST Know 💡 Understanding scope and closure is key to mastering JavaScript . 🔹 Scope determines where variables are accessible. Global Scope Function Scope Block Scope (let & const) 🔹 Closure is when a function “remembers” variables from its outer scope even after the outer function has finished execution. 👉 Simple Example: A function inside another function can access the parent function’s variables — that’s closure in action. 📌 Why it matters: Helps in data hiding (encapsulation) Used in callbacks, event handlers, and async code Essential for writing clean and efficient code 🚀 If you're preparing for interviews or building projects, mastering these concepts will level up your JavaScript skills. #JavaScript #WebDevelopment #FrontendDevelopment #Coding #Programming #MERNStack #InterviewPreparation #LearnToCode #Developers #TechSkills
